On May 21, there will be a Bone Marrow Drive and Fundraiser for one of our local 3rd grade students, Colby Byrd. You have probably read about his situation in the newspapers and may have attended other fundraisers for him. He is fighting his 3rd battle with Acute Lymphocytic Leukemia and needs a bone marrow transplant this time. He has been undergoing chemotherapy in Chapel Hill since ...

Memorial Ride For our Fallen Heros of the 120th CAB

Ang Spivey Norris Invited you
Time
Saturday, July 9 · 10:00am - 2:00pm
 
Location
Starting at Walmart in Whiteville NC- Ending at the Memorial At the National Guard Armory, Wilmington NC


More Info
10 am starts registration, 11 am the bikes roll out. $20 per bike $25 with passenger. This is a join Sponsership between Veterans of Foreign Wars Post 8073 and The columbus county Concerned Bikers Association. For more info contact Paul Spivey at 910-840-733
